The Red Pink color palette is a dynamic and captivating combination of hues that evoke feelings of energy, passion, and excitement. At its core, this palette is a masterful blend of monochromatic shades that work together in perfect harmony to create a truly immersive visual experience. As the eye moves through the palette, it is drawn to the deep, rich tones of DD1717, a bold and vibrant red that sets the tone for the entire color scheme. This powerful shade is perfectly balanced by the slightly more orange-tinged FB3310, which adds a sense of warmth and playfulness to the palette.

As we delve deeper into the Red Pink palette, we find a range of shades that each bring their own unique character to the table. F40D30, with its slightly purplish undertones, adds a sense of sophistication and elegance, while C70E0E brings a sense of earthy, natural charm to the palette. Finally, D6204E, with its bright, poppy quality, adds a touch of fun and whimsy, rounding out the palette and creating a sense of dynamic tension. Throughout the palette, each shade works together to create a sense of continuity and flow, with the subtle variations in tone and hue creating a sense of visual interest and depth.

The Red Pink palette is incredibly versatile, and can be used in a wide range of design applications, from websites and apps to branding and marketing materials. Its bold, eye-catching colors make it perfect for use in attention-grabbing headlines, calls to action, and other interactive elements. At the same time, the palette’s more subdued shades can be used to create a sense of balance and calm, making it an excellent choice for backgrounds, textures, and other design elements. Whether you’re looking to create a bold, energetic design or a more subtle, nuanced one, the Red Pink palette has the range and flexibility to meet your needs.

The colors in the Red Pink palette also have a profound impact on viewer perception and behavior. Red, in particular, is a color that is closely associated with passion, energy, and excitement, and can be used to stimulate feelings of urgency and motivation. The palette’s more orange-tinged shades, such as FB3310 and F40D30, can also be used to create a sense of warmth and approachability, making them perfect for use in designs where you want to create a sense of connection and community. By carefully selecting and combining these colors, designers can create a powerful emotional connection with their audience, and drive engagement and conversion.

For designers looking to get the most out of the Red Pink palette, there are a few key tips and tricks to keep in mind. One of the most important is to balance the palette’s bold, vibrant colors with more neutral or complementary shades, such as blues or greens, to create a sense of visual harmony and balance. The palette’s colors can also be paired with a range of other hues, from deep, rich browns and tans to bright, poppy yellows and oranges, to create a wide range of different moods and effects. By experimenting with different combinations and pairings, designers can unlock the full potential of the Red Pink palette, and create designs that are truly unique and effective.
